Default dynamat

i have a 400 hp olds and used dynamat extreme on all interior floorpan and regular dynamat in trunk . i noticed a large noise reduction and noticed a big difference when i did the doors later. it takes the noise and makes it a lower tone for what you do hear. i like the idea using it on wheelwells so not to tear the interior apart. i have taken my olds apart so many times it is scary , but not the electronics and hardwhare that the vette has.

***Two big helpful hints! ***
Wear mechanics gloves or something for two resons. If the Dynamat gets under you nails, it's gonna be there a while. Secondly, the foil part of it cuts the $h*T out of your fingers. Trust me. I lived and learned.
